Motherboard RAM Slot Not Working? Here's the Real Fix

Hardware – RAM & MB Intermediate 👁 11 views 📅 May 26, 2026

A dead RAM slot is usually a bent CPU pin or bad memory channel. Don't replace the board until you check these three things first.

1. Bent CPU Pins (The Real Culprit 80% of the Time)

I can't tell you how many times I've seen someone RMA a motherboard over a dead RAM slot, only to find the real problem was a bent pin in the CPU socket. This happens most often on LGA sockets (Intel LGA 1151, 1200, 1700, AMD AM5). You install a cooler, bump the board, or don't seat the CPU evenly — and one tiny pin bends. That pin might control a specific memory channel.

The fix: pull the cooler and CPU. Grab a bright flashlight and a magnifying glass (or a phone camera zoomed in). Look at the socket pins from multiple angles. Bent pins are obvious — they catch the light differently. Straighten them with a mechanical pencil tip (the graphite won't short) or a fine needle. Be gentle. I've fixed dozens of boards this way.

If you're on an AMD AM4/AM5 PGA socket (pins on the CPU), inspect the CPU pins themselves. Same deal — look for bent or missing pins near the corner that handles memory channel A or B.

2. Bad Memory Channel or CPU Memory Controller

Sometimes it's not a bent pin, but a failed memory channel in the CPU's integrated memory controller (IMC). This is less common but still happens, especially on older Ryzen 1000/2000 series or first-gen Intel Core i7/i9 chips that you've pushed hard with XMP.

How to test it: Swap the suspect RAM stick to a known working slot. If the stick works fine in slot A2 but not in B2, the slot or channel is the problem. Then try that same RAM stick in B1. If it works in B1 but not B2, the slot is bad. If neither B1 nor B2 works, the CPU's memory channel is dead.

The fix: If it's the CPU, replace it. Yes, that's a pain. But before you do, try a BIOS update. I've seen board BIOS updates fix memory channel detection issues on ASUS Z690 and Gigabyte B450 boards. It's a long shot, but it's free.

3. RAM Slot Contact Corrosion or Debris

This one's dirt simple but easy to overlook. Dust, thermal paste drips, or even a tiny piece of plastic from the RAM stick's packaging can block a slot contact. I pulled a dead slot back to life on a customer's Dell Optiplex 3070 by blasting it with compressed air and scraping a bit of thermal paste off the slot divider with a plastic spudger.

Check the slot visually — shine a light in there. Look for anything that shouldn't be there. If the contacts look tarnished (dull, not shiny), clean them with 99% isopropyl alcohol and a lint-free swab. Don't use a pencil eraser — it leaves residue.

Also, reseat the RAM stick a few times. Sometimes the gold contacts just need a little friction to wipe off oxidation. Push the stick in firmly until both clips click. I can't count the times I've seen a stick not fully seated, especially on boards with asymmetric slot designs (like MSI MAG Z790).

Quick-Reference Summary Table

CauseHow to ConfirmFix
Bent CPU pin (LGA/PGA)Visual inspection of socket or CPU pinsStraighten pin or replace CPU
Failed memory channel (IMC)RAM works in A slots but not B slotsReplace CPU or update BIOS
Slot debris or corrosionVisible dirt, dull contacts, or RAM not clickingClean slot with alcohol, reseat RAM

Bottom line: Don't throw money at a new motherboard until you've checked the CPU socket. That's where the problem is hiding 4 out of 5 times.
